The ‘DuckTales’ Reboot Is Coming To An End After Only Three Seasons

It was hailed as a worthy successor to the beloved ’80s original, but, sadly, the reboot of DuckTales is coming to an end, and only after three seasons. According to Deadline, Disney XD has decided not to pursue a fourth spin with unimaginably wealthy Scrooge McDuck and his precocious nephews Huey, Dewey, and Louie. Hopefully this doesn’t affect Seth Rogen’s proposed redo of Darkwing Duck, another Disney staple from the same era.

Mind you, the original DuckTales didn’t last much longer. After debuting in 1987, the weekday afternoon show only four seasons, with a theatrical movie, Treasure of the Lost Lamp, squeezed in between the third and final gos. The revival began in 2017, and it did a do-over, starting anew with Scotsduck Scrooge forced to babysit his nephews, and quickly realizing that they inspire him to go off on daring explorations and get into assorted mischief. The cast was big, too, with David Tenant doing Scrooge and other roles voiced by Danny Pudi, Ben Schwartz, Bobby Moynihan, and Kate Micucci. It even gave a more sizable role to Donald Duck.

You can still watch its 65 episodes, which may be well shy of the original’s cool 100, but that’s nothing to sneeze at. May Scrooge McDuck get to do laps in his money bin another day.

Joyner Lucas Admits That The Cause Of His Beef With Logic Was That He Was ‘Jealous’

For the first time in nearly four years, Joyner Lucas and Logic reunited, teaming up for their track “Isis” off the former’s debut album, ADHD. The collaboration came after a long beef, which started when the rappers did not see eye to eye after a disagreement they had while working on Tech N9ne’s 2016 track “Sriracha.” Lucas stopped by The Breakfast Club, where he was asked about the origins of their feud.

“I think I was jealous of him,” Joyner said after Charlamagne Tha God asked him the question. “But I think… The reason why I say that, though, is because I felt like where he was at at the time is where I wanted to be so much.” He explained how Royce Da 5’9″ helped him patch things up with Logic. “I had called that man because I had an epiphany,” he said. “I had got to a certain place, in which people started expecting things of me. And people started expecting that I just do sh*t. People that I didn’t really know like that. And, I lost a lot of people and it clicked. I said everything that I accused this guy of or I was [jealous] of, it’s happening to me. I know how it feels and it sucks.”

Joyner also revealed what he said to Logic to heal the rift, saying, “I felt like I was jealous of you because you were doing everything I wanted to do. You were dope, you were lyrical. You was ripping down tours. You had all these relationships with all these artists that I loved and respected. And, I really idolized you and I didn’t even realize how much I did.”

The Rockets Traded Russell Westbrook To The Wizards For John Wall

The long-rumored trade between the Houston Rockets and the Washington Wizards that featured a pair of high-profile point guards has finally happened. According to Adrian Wojnarowski of ESPN, Russell Westbrook is headed to D.C. in a trade that will see John Wall go to the Lone Star State. In terms of added compensation to make the move happen, the Wizards attached a future first-round pick.

Shams Charania of The Athletic confirmed the trade, noting that the first is a protected selection in the 2023 NBA Draft.

Rumors had been swirling for some time that Westbrook wanted out of Houston, with word leaking that he wanted a deal shortly after a story went public about him and James Harden having concerns about directions of the franchise. Wall came into this soon after, with his contract being such that he could be flipped for Westbrook. Following word of talks about this sort of move hitting the internet, word then came out that Wall wanted out of the nation’s capital.

It’s a fascinating trade of two highly-paid athletes with questions about what they can do in the NBA in 2020 — Westbrook struggled until the Rockets embraced microball and then struggled in the NBA’s Orlando Bubble following a bout with COVID-19, while Wall has been dealing with injuries for years and has not appeared in a game since late 2018. Now, the pair are getting moved for one another, and in the aftermath, all eyes will turn to their star running mates — Harden in Houston and Bradley Beal in Washington — about what the future holds for them.

G Herbo Has Been Charged In Connection With A Massachusetts Federal Fraud Case

On Wednesday, G Herbo found himself in hot water after being named in a federal fraud case brought up in Massachusetts. According to the Chicago Tribune, the PTSD rapper, whose real name is Herbert Wright III, his music promoter, and other members of his crew are accused of fraud and identity theft. The case alleges that Herbo and his crew used stolen IDs to access more than one million dollars worth of luxury items over a four-year period.

According to court documents, Herbo and company allegedly used the money for private jets, limousine rides, car rentals, a villa in Jamaica, and the purchase of two designer puppies. The charges were initially filed in September through a Springfield, Massachusetts U.S. District Court, but the court documents were not made public until Wednesday. The 14-count indictment charges all members with conspiracy to commit wire fraud and aggravated identity theft. Herbo also faces an additional charge of wire fraud as well.

Antonio “T-Glo” Strong, who is Herbo’s music promoter, was, as per the Tribune, “alleged to be the ringleader of a $1.5 million fraud” by U.S. District Judge Robert Dow. As for Herbo himself, it’s unclear if he’s made any plans to appear in court to face charges. The charges also come days after he was included on the 2020 issue of the Forbes 30 Under 30 list.

Andy Garcia Says He Never Understood Why Many People Were So Hard On ‘The Godfather Part III’

The Godfather Part III never got the love its two predecessors did. Quite the contrary: Its reputation is so bad that Francis Ford Coppola went back, three decades later, to make a new (and many say better) cut. But when it came out, the reaction wasn’t so hostile. It even received seven Oscar nominations, including one for Best Picture. Another was for Andy García, who played Michael Corleone’s hotheaded nephew Vincent, and received across-the-board raves. It was a big moment for García, and he, at least, has never understood the hate.

In a new interview about the new cut — entitled The Godfather Coda: The Death of Michael Corleonewith The Hollywood Reporter, García defended the film that helped make him a star. “I never had an issue with the first one, but I am very close to it,” he said, saying that the negative press it received — especially re: Sofia Coppola’s performance — was not always fair. “I thought a lot of things were unjust about it, especially how Sofia was treated.”

García does admit that the new cut is excellent. “There is a clarity to this version that Francis wanted,” he said. But he hopes people will give the original version another chance. “I think if people revisit this film, they will see a very honest, deep and soulful performance by Sofia. I think there is great tragedy in the character, a very courageous performance, and I am very proud of the work we did.”

The NBA Had 48 Players Test Positive Out Of 546 Tests Administered Last Week

The NBA brought players back to their home markets last week and began to administer COVID-19 testing in preparation for facilities opening up and training camp beginning on December 1. The league’s efforts to start a season outside of a bubble atmosphere presents a precarious situation with the understanding that positive tests will happen, and it’s simply a matter of the league and teams trying to do their best to mitigate positive tests and the potential spread through a team.

On Wednesday, the league announced the results from their first round of testing last week and, unsurprisingly, there were a fairly significant number of positive tests. The NBA said 48 players tested positive out of 546 tests (8.8 percent positivity rate) and those players are now in isolation and will follow CDC guidelines prior to their return to team facilities. Positive tests were expected, so this is not something that is catching the league off guard, and the upcoming rounds of testing will be far more indicative of whether this season is able to begin as planned and have any kind of successful start. The Warriors have already announced they had two of those positive tests and as a result have pushed the start of their full team workouts back a day from Sunday to Monday of next week.

The positivity rate should begin to decline, particularly during camp, but this will be an ongoing issue for the league as they begin traveling and playing games. We have seen how difficult it has been for the NFL to get through this season, and they have the benefit of playing games just once a week with significantly less travel. The NBA schedule will tell us a lot about how the league plans to handle the travel load of teams and while they’ve been insistent on having as normal a season as possible, how they set up team travel schedules for road trips is more important than ever to try and limit the possibility of spread.

The delightful—and timely—story of how ‘A Spoonful of Sugar’ ended up in ‘Mary Poppins’

Just a spoonful of sugar makes the medicine go down…in the most delightful way.

There are certain songs from kids’ movies that most of us can sing along to, but we often don’t know how they originated. Now we have a timely insight into one such song—”A Spoonful of Sugar” from “Mary Poppins.”

It’s common for parents to try all kinds of tricks to get kids to take medications they don’t want to take, but the inspiration for “A Spoonful of Sugar” was much more specific. Jeffrey Sherman, the son and nephew of the Sherman Brothers—the musical duo responsible not just for “Mary Poppins,” but a host of Disney films including “Chitty Chitty Bang Bang,” “The Jungle Book,” “The Aristocats,” as well as the song “It’s a Small World After All”—told the story of how “A Spoonful of Sugar” came about on Facebook.

He wrote:


“When I was a kid, they rolled out a vaccine for polio. We were given it at school on a sugar cube. I went home and my dad, who was working on Mary Poppins, asked how my day was.

What I didn’t know was that Julie Andrews who was hired to play Mary had not really liked the song my dad and uncle had written -‘Through the Eyes of Love’ – and it was rejected. It was their favorite song for the movie.

Walt asked the Sherman Brothers to come up with a new song that would be in line with Mary’s //Julie’s philosophy.

Dad asked me how my day was and I told him about getting the polio vaccine at school.

I was known for rejecting the booster shots at my doctors’ office and running away.

He said, ‘Didn’t it hurt?’

I told him they put it on a sugar cube and you just ate it.

He stared at me, then went to the phone and called my uncle Dick.

They went back to the office and wrote -‘A Spoonful of Sugar’ (‘Helps the Medicine Go Down.’)

It’s my little corner of film music history I suppose. Inadvertently.”

The Hippies Were Right All Along — The UN Has Declared Weed A Medicine

History was made at the United Nations today, when the UN’s Commission for Narcotic Drugs narrowly voted to remove cannabis from a list of drugs previously judged to have little-to-no medicinal benefits. Vice reports that in a 27 to 25 vote victory, the US and UN cast the final two deciding votes to now officially remove cannabis from Schedule IV of the 1961 Single Convention on Narcotic Drugs — potentially opening up the plant to increased medicinal access throughout Europe, along with additional scientific research.

Translation: Your stoner cousin was right — weed is medicine. And now we’re a significant step closer to being able to get the type of research funded that will tell us precisely how it’s best used. The legal status of cannabis has always been a major hurdle when it comes to funding meaningful scientific research studying the long term medicinal benefits of THC, so the United Nations recognizing the medical value of weed remedies some of the unjust prejudice that has been unfairly placed on the plant, despite the historical use of cannabis as a medicine that stretches back to ancient Greece and Egypt. And, as we’ve covered before, medicinal recognition leads to medical legalization which always, always leads to eventual recreational legalization. So this move is a big win for weed worldwide.

To date, 50 countries worldwide have adopted medicinal cannabis programs, and the plant is now fully legal in Canada, Uruguay, and 15 US states. Mexico and Luxembourg are also expected to join the countries that have legalized weed in the near future, with the vote passing Mexico’s senate just days ago.
